How To Fix WG026 - EAN & not found. Item cannot be identified


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: WG - Messages for store order and investment buy

  • Message number: 026

  • Message text: EAN & not found. Item cannot be identified

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The intemediate document segment does not contain a useful EAN.
    Therefore the order item cannot be identified.

    System Response

    The order item is not posted.

    How to fix this error?

    Transmit a useful order item identifier.

    Certainly! Here's a detailed explanation for the SAP error message WG026: "EAN & not found. Item cannot be identified":


    Error Message:

    WG026 - EAN & not found. Item cannot be identified


    Cause:

    This error occurs when the system tries to identify a material/item using the provided EAN (European Article Number) or barcode, but it cannot find any material master record associated with that EAN in the system.

    In other words, the EAN scanned or entered does not exist in the material master data or the EAN/UPC code is not maintained in the system for any material.


    Common Scenarios:

    • Scanning or entering a barcode/EAN that is not maintained in the material master.
    • The EAN is maintained but in a different plant or sales organization, and the current context does not have access to it.
    • The EAN master data is incomplete or missing.
    • The EAN is maintained in a different unit of measure or material variant that is not recognized in the current transaction.

    Solution:

    1. Check if the EAN is maintained in the material master:

      • Use transaction MM03 (Display Material) and check the EAN/UPC tab to verify if the EAN is assigned to any material.
      • Alternatively, use transaction MMBE or SE16N on table MARA or EANLH to search for the EAN.
    2. Maintain the missing EAN:

      • If the EAN is not maintained, add it using transaction MM02 (Change Material) under the Additional Data ? EAN/UPC tab.
      • Ensure the EAN is maintained for the correct plant and sales organization if applicable.
    3. Check the material master data consistency:

      • Verify that the material is active and valid for the relevant plant.
      • Check if the material is blocked or flagged for deletion.
    4. Check the transaction context:

      • Ensure that the transaction or process you are using supports EAN identification.
      • Verify if the EAN is maintained in the correct unit of measure.
    5. If using barcode scanning devices:

      • Confirm that the barcode scanner is reading the correct EAN.
      • Validate the barcode format and ensure it matches the EAN maintained in SAP.

    Related Information:

    • Tables involved:

      • MARA (General Material Data)
      • MARC (Plant Data for Material)
      • EANLH (EAN/UPC Codes)
      • MARM (Units of Measure for Material)
    • Transactions:

      • MM03 - Display Material
      • MM02 - Change Material (to maintain EAN)
      • SE16N - Data Browser (to check tables)
      • VL01N / VL02N - Delivery creation/change (where EAN scanning might be used)
    • Notes:

      • EAN codes must be unique and correctly maintained to avoid identification issues.
      • In some industries, EAN maintenance is critical for logistics and sales processes.

    Summary:

    The error WG026 indicates that the system cannot find the material corresponding to the entered or scanned EAN. The primary fix is to ensure that the EAN is correctly maintained in the material master data for the relevant plant and sales area.
